[Top][All Lists]
[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
[Qemu-devel] [PATCH 3/7] lsi53c895a: Add support for LSI53C700 Family Co
From: |
Jan Kiszka |
Subject: |
[Qemu-devel] [PATCH 3/7] lsi53c895a: Add support for LSI53C700 Family Compatibility bit |
Date: |
Thu, 19 Nov 2009 11:07:12 +0100 |
User-agent: |
StGIT/0.14.3 |
From: Laszlo Ast <address@hidden>
Signed-off-by: Laszlo Ast <address@hidden>
Signed-off-by: Jan Kiszka <address@hidden>
---
hw/lsi53c895a.c | 4 ++++
1 files changed, 4 insertions(+), 0 deletions(-)
diff --git a/hw/lsi53c895a.c b/hw/lsi53c895a.c
index e618bf2..ee69b0a 100644
--- a/hw/lsi53c895a.c
+++ b/hw/lsi53c895a.c
@@ -583,6 +583,10 @@ static void lsi_reselect(LSIState *s, uint32_t tag)
}
id = (tag >> 8) & 0xf;
s->ssid = id | 0x80;
+ /* LSI53C700 Family Compatibility, see LSI53C895A 4-73 */
+ if (!s->dcntl & LSI_DCNTL_COM) {
+ s->sfbr = 1 << (id & 0x7);
+ }
DPRINTF("Reselected target %d\n", id);
s->current_dev = s->bus.devs[id];
s->current_tag = tag;
- [Qemu-devel] [PATCH 0/7] scsi & lsi53c895a fixes, Jan Kiszka, 2009/11/19
- [Qemu-devel] [PATCH 3/7] lsi53c895a: Add support for LSI53C700 Family Compatibility bit,
Jan Kiszka <=
- [Qemu-devel] [PATCH 6/7] lsi53c895a: Use alternative address when already reselected, Jan Kiszka, 2009/11/19
- [Qemu-devel] [PATCH 1/7] SCSI: Fix Standard INQUIRY data, Jan Kiszka, 2009/11/19
- [Qemu-devel] [PATCH 4/7] lsi53c895a: Fix message code of DISCONNECT, Jan Kiszka, 2009/11/19
- [Qemu-devel] [PATCH 2/7] lsi53c895a: Whitespace and typo fixes, Jan Kiszka, 2009/11/19
- [Qemu-devel] [PATCH 7/7] lsi53c895a: Implement IRQ on reselection, Jan Kiszka, 2009/11/19
- [Qemu-devel] [PATCH 5/7] lsi53c895a: Fix SDID in SELECT ID command, Jan Kiszka, 2009/11/19